The city of Philadelphia is infamous for its rousing sport fans, cheesesteaks, and brotherly love. Brick, Quik, and Firestarter make up the members of the team The Trio, the go-to ensemble that always seem to find themselves over their heads when they take on vampires, city thugs, the police, and bickering with each other as Arcana Studios announces the debut of PHILLY!
“They have the looks, they have the powers, but they quite don’t have the concept of actually being a superhero team,” says series creator Ryan McLelland, writer/columnist for Newsarama (the most reputable and popular publication of any kind covering the comic book industry) and his creator owned comic Wise Intelligence. “I wanted to do a book about a superhero team who fight the evils of the world but their personalities usually get in the way of their goals. So one member might show up for a fight with an evil villain while one is drinking at a bar and the other used his powers to run to Japan to buy a new videogame. This being Philadelphia the team also has to deal with the community who loves them when they do right and hate them whenever they mess up.”

Joining McLelland is rising star Jim Hanna whose brilliant artwork helps bring the world of PHILLY to life. “Jim has an incredible ability to draw superheroes and it shows the second you look at his artwork. He loves drawing PHILLY and it truly shows in every single page in the book.”
With its colorful characters and huge action it’s easy to see why PHILLY is the most anticipated release of 2007. PHILLY #1 ordering information is available through Diamond’s February Previews (FEB073153) with a cover price of $3.95.
